  text: "Nowadays companies operate in a difficult environment: the dynamics of innovations
    increase and product life cycles become shorter. Furthermore products and the
    corresponding manufacturing processes get more and more complex. Therefore, companies
    need new methods for the planning of manufacturing systems. One promising approach
    in this context is digital factory/virtual production\x97the modeling and analysis
    of computer models of the planned factory with the objective to reduce time and
    costs. For the modeling and analysis various simulation methods and programs have
    been developed. They are a highly valuable support for planning and visualizing
    the manufacturing system. But there is one major disadvantage: only experienced
    and long trained experts are able to operate with these programs. The graphical
    user interface is very complex and not intuitive to use. This results in an extensive
    and error-prone modeling of complex simulation models and a time-consuming interpretation
    of the simulation results.\r\n\r\nTo overcome these weak points, intuitive and
    understandable man\x96machine interfaces like augmented and virtual reality can
    be used. This paper describes the architecture of a system which uses the technologies
    of augmented and virtual reality to support the planning process of complex manufacturing
    systems. The proposed system assists the user in modeling, the validation of the
    simulation model, and the subsequent optimization of the production system. A
    general application of the VR- and AR-technologies and of the simulation is realized
    by the development of appropriate linking and integration mechanisms. For the
    visualization of the arising 3D-data within the VR- and AR-environments, a dedicated
    3D-rendering library is used."

  text: "Property testing is a relaxation of classical decision problems which aims
    at distinguishing between functions having a predetermined property and functions
    being far from any function having the property. In this paper we present a novel
    framework for analyzing property testing algorithms. Our framework is based on
    a connection of property testing and a new class of problems which we call abstract
    combinatorial programs . We show that if the problem of testing a property can
    be reduced to an abstract combinatorial program of small dimension , then the
    property has an efficient tester.\r\n\r\nWe apply our framework to a variety of
    problems. We present efficient property testing algorithms for geometric clustering
    problems, for the reversal distance problem, and for graph and hypergraph coloring
    problems. We also prove that, informally, any hereditary graph property can be
    efficiently tested if and only if it can be reduced to an abstract combinatorial
    program of small size.\r\n\r\nOur framework allows us to analyze all our testers
    in a unified way, and the obtained complexity bounds either match or improve the
    previously known bounds. Furthermore, even if the asymptotic complexity of the
    testers is not improved, the obtained proofs are significantly simpler than the
    previous ones. We believe that our framework will help to understand the structure
    of efficiently testable properties."

  text: A dynamic geometric data stream consists of a sequence of m insert/delete
    operations of points from the discrete space {1,..., ∆} d [26]. We develop streaming
    (1 + ɛ)-approximation algorithms for k-median, k-means, MaxCut, maximum weighted
    matching (MaxWM), maximum travelling salesperson (MaxTSP), maximum spanning tree
    (MaxST), and average distance over dynamic geometric data streams. Our algorithms
    maintain a small weighted set of points (a coreset) that approximates with probability
    2/3 the current point set with respect to the considered problem during the m
    insert/delete operations of the data stream. They use poly(ɛ −1, log m, log ∆)
    space and update time per insert/delete operation for constant k and dimension
    d. Having a coreset one only needs a fast approximation algorithm for the weighted
    problem to compute a solution quickly. In fact, even an exponential algorithm
    is sometimes feasible as its running time may still be polynomial in n. For example
    one can compute in poly(log n, exp(O((1+log(1/ɛ)/ɛ) d−1))) time a solution to
    k-median and k-means [21] where n is the size of the current point set and k and
    d are constants. Finding an implicit solution to MaxCut can be done in poly(log
    n, exp((1/ɛ) O(1))) time. For MaxST and average distance we require poly(log n,
    ɛ −1) time and for MaxWM we require O(n 3) time to do this.

  text: "We consider the problem of computing the weight of a Euclidean minimum spanning
    tree for a set of n points in $\\mathbb R^d$. We focus on the setting where the
    input point set is supported by certain basic (and commonly used) geometric data
    structures that can provide efficient access to the input in a structured way.
    We present an algorithm that estimates with high probability the weight of a Euclidean
    minimum spanning tree of a set of points to within $1 + \\eps$ using only $\\widetilde{\\O}(\\sqrt{n}
    \\, \\text{poly} (1/\\eps))$ queries for constant d. The algorithm assumes that
    the input is supported by a minimal bounding cube enclosing it, by orthogonal
    range queries, and by cone approximate nearest neighbor queries.\r\n\r\n\r\nRead

  text: Modern computer graphics systems are able to render sophisticated 3D szenes
    consisting of millions of polygons. In this paper we address the problem of occlusion
    culling. Aila, Miettinen, and Nordlund suggested to implement a FIFO buffer on
    graphics cards which is able to delay the polygons before drawing them. When one
    of the polygons within the buffer is occluded or masked by another polygon arriving
    later from the application, the rendering engine can drop the occluded one without
    rendering, saving important rendering time.<br>We introduce a theoretical online
    model to analyse these problems in theory using competitive analysis. For different
    cost measures addressed we invent the first competitive algorithms for online
    occlusion culling. Our implementation shows that these algorithms outperform known
    ones for real 3D scenes as well.

  text: The page migration problem is one of subproblems of data management in networks.
    It occurs<br>in a distributed network of processors sharing one indivisible memory
    page of size D. During runtime,<br>the processors access a unit of data from the
    page, and the system is allowed to migrate the page <br>between the processors.
    The problem is to compute (on-line) a schedule of page movements <br>to minimize
    the total communication cost. <br><br>The Dynamic Page Migration problem is an
    extension to the page migration. <br>It attempts to model the network dynamics,
    occurring, for example, in mobile networks.<br>However, the pace of changes is
    restricted, i.e. the distances between processors can <br>change only by a constant
    per round.  <br><br>The movement of the nodes induce changes in the communication
    cost between each pair of nodes,  <br>which is proportional to the distance between
    them raised to some power $alpha$.<br>This is typical for mobile wireless networks,
    where nodes can move with a constant speed,<br>and the cost of communication is
    measured in terms of energy used for sending the data.<br>Thus, by setting $alpha$
    equal to the propagation exponent of the medium, <br>cost minimization becomes
    minimizing the total energy consumption in the system. <br><br>However, as proven
    in citedynamic-page-migration, if both network mobility and <br>request sequence
    are created by an adversary, then the competitive ratio is polynomially large
    in D and <br>in the number of the nodes. In our search for a reasonable, close-to-reality
    model, in this paper we <br>consider a scenario in which the network mobility
    is adversarial, but the requests are <br>generated randomly by a stochastic process.
    We design an algorithm MTFR for this scenario,<br>and prove that it is O(1)-competitive,
    on expectation and with high probability.

  text: Bluetooth is a wireless communication standard developed for personal area
    networks (PAN) that gained popularity in the last years. It was designed to connect
    a few devices together, however nowadays there is a need to build larger networks.
    Construction and maintenance algorithms have great effect on performance of the
    network. We present an algorithm based on Cube Connected Cycles (CCC) topology
    and show how to maintain the network so that it is easily scalable. Our design
    guarantees good properties such as constant degree and logarithmic dilation. Besides,
    the construction costs are proven to be at most constant times larger than any
    other algorithm would need.

  text: The dynamic page migration problem citedynamic-page-migration is defined in
    <br>a distributed network of $n$ mobile nodes sharing one indivisible memory page
    <br>of size $D$. During runtime, the nodes can both access a unit of data from<br>the
    page and move with a constant speed, thus changing the costs of communication.<br>The
    problem is to compute <em> online</em> a schedule of page movements<br>to minimize
    the total communication cost.<br><br>In this paper we construct and analyze the
    first deterministic algorithm for this problem. <br>We prove that it achieves
    an (up to a constant factor) optimal competitive ratio <br>$O(n cdot sqrtD)$.
    We show that the randomization of this algorithm <br>improves this ratio to $O(sqrtD
    cdot log n)$ (against an oblivious adversary). <br>This substantially improves
    an $O(n cdot sqrtD)$ upper bound from citedynamic-page-migration.<br>We also give
    an almost matching lower bound of $Omega(sqrtD cdot sqrtlog n)$ for this problem.

  text: A dynamic geometric data stream is a sequence of m Add/Remove operations of
    points from a discrete geometric space (1,...,Δ)d [21]. Add(p) inserts a point
    p from (1,...,Δ)d into the current point set, Remove(p) deletes p from P. We develop
    low-storage data structures to (i) maintain ε-approximations of range spaces of
    P with constant VC-dimension and (ii) maintain an ε-approximation of the weight
    of the Euclidean minimum spanning tree of P. Our data structures use O(log3ε •
    log3(1/ε) • log(1/ε)/ε2) and O(log (1/δ) • (log Δ/ε)O(d)) bits of memory, respectively
    (we assume that the dimension d is a constant), and they are correct with probability
    1-δ. These results are based on a new data structure that maintains a set of elements
    chosen (almost) uniformly at random from P.

  text: The sometimes so-called Main Theorem of Recursive Analysis implies that any
    computable real function is necessarily continuous. We consider three relaxations
    of this common notion of real computability for the purpose of treating also discontinuous
    functions f:R->R:<br>*) non-deterministic computation;<br>*) relativized computation,
    specifically given access to oracles like 0' or 0'';<br>*) encoding input x and/or
    output y=f(x) in weaker ways according to the Real Arithmetic Hierarchy.<br>It
    turns out that, among these approaches, only the first one provides the required
    power.
